wastefulness
Noun
-
The trait of wasting resources (synset 104902159)
"a life characterized by thriftlessness and waste"; "the wastefulness of missed opportunities"is a type of: improvidence, shortsightedness - a lack of prudence and care by someone in the management of resourcessame as: thriftlessness, waste
-
Useless or profitless activity;
Using or expending or consuming thoughtlessly or carelessly (synset 100743943)"if the effort brings no compensating gain it is a waste"; "mindless dissipation of natural resources"is a type of: activity - any specific behaviorsubtypes:- boondoggle - work of little or no value done merely to look busy
- waste of effort, waste of energy - a useless effort
- waste of material - a useless consumption of material
- waste of money - money spent for inadequate return
- waste of time - the devotion of time to a useless activity
- extravagance, high life, highlife, lavishness, prodigality - excessive spending
- squandering - spending resources lavishly and wastefully
same as: dissipation, waste
